Abstract
This study was conducted to investigate the economic value of changes in soil chemistry and carbon accumulation during no-till organic cultivation of rice based on Korea’s traditional agriculture. The test method was to cut and reduce the rice straw produced in the test treatment area. The test processing conducted under organic cultivation conditions with no input (no externally produced materials such as organic and inorganic fertilizers, pesticides, and herbicides etc.) except agricultural water and rainfall. The test treatments were pre-transplant tillage and no-till, and were conducted from 2017 to 2023. This study is the first report of them. In the no-till treatment, water was removed 1 day before transplanting, and seedlings were grown simultaneously with partial tillage. The transplanted seedlings were transplanted. In organic cultivation, the Ca content and cation exchange capacity (CEC) of tilled soil were lower in subsoil compared to topsoil. The soluble phosphoric acid (P2O4) content of no-till soil was increased compared to that of tillage soil.
